Cornus alba 'Ivory Halo' is an improvement of the Elegantissima. It has crimson twigs during winter and crimson leaf discolouration in autumn. During the spring and summer, his leaves are gray-green with a silvery edge. Cornus alba loves acidic and moist soils and does well in full sun to partial shade.
